Test Principle
This ELISA kit uses the Competitive-ELISA principle. The micro ELISA plate provided in this kit has been pre-coated with Universal PGI2. During the reaction, Universal PGI2 in the sample or standard competes with a fixed amount of Universal PGI2 on the solid phase supporter for sites on the Biotinylated Detection Ab specific to Universal PGI2. Excess conjugate and unbound sample or standard are washed away, and Avidin-Horseradish Peroxidase (HRP) conjugate are added to each micro plate well and incubated. Then a TMB substrate solution is added to each well. The enzyme-substrate reaction is terminated by the addition of stop solution and the color turns from blue to yellow. The optical density (OD) is measured spectrophotometrically at a wavelength of 450 nm ± 2 nm. The concentration of Universal PGI2 in tested samples can be calculated by comparing the OD of the samples to the standard curve.
Background
Prostacyclin (PGI2) is involved in platelet aggregation, vasoconstriction, and reproductive functions. PGI2 has a half life of 60 minutes in plasma but only 2 to 3 minutes in buffer. The production of PGI2 is typically monitored by measurement of 6k-PGF1α and 2,3d-6k- PGF1α. 6-keto- PGF1α is produced by the non-enzymatic hydration of PGI2, and is further metabolized in urine to the 2,3-dinor derivative. A number of pharmaceuticals alter and无or inhibit the synthesis of PGI2. Methods to measure PGI2 in urine typically involve HPLC, gas chromatography无mass spectrometry, or radioimmunoassay and enzyme immunoassay for 6k- PGF1α.
